I use this website very often: soapee.com

It doesn't use http, https, or even www.

I cannot access it at all anymore, and cannot add an Exception. I don't care if it doesn't have a certificate, or something is expired - I just want to access the site. There's nothing on the site that is a risk for me - just a bunch of recipes. IE/Chrome are no problem, but I won't use any browser except Firefox.

Can someone help?

You need to use the http:// protocol to access this website. Firefox hides the http:// protocol (i.e. only shows the protocol (https://) if you use a secure connection).

I need to disable Tracking Protection to get the actual web page content.

o. m. gee. I turned off my extensions and the site came right up.

Is there a way to tell which extension is the problem?

I really really thought I had tried this already!

more options

So weird... it's the Facebook Container extension. How is that possible? What does it have to do with other websites?
